Transaction 42e753f77ce104adbfb6bf2df95dc859f6551b2dfaa725ed622b08dc4b104bd1
1 Input
1 Output
-
42e753f77ce104adbfb6bf2df95dc859f6551b2dfaa725ed622b08dc4b104bd1:0
- value
- 5370000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f75ee3dc888e3de409d552880bf8feea15b000e4 OP_EQUAL
- address
- 3QEzW1DJxi5zVBWyaSN2stxY6vWUg1XmsZ